Before diving into the exercises, it’s important to warm up your muscles and prepare your body for the intensity of the workout. This will help reduce the risk of injury and improve performance during the routine.
For the main portion of the workout, perform each exercise for 40 seconds followed by 20 seconds of rest. Complete the circuit twice for a total of 12 minutes of exercise.
After completing the workout, it’s important to cool down to help your muscles recover and prevent stiffness. This will also lower your heart rate gradually.
